10 Benefits of a Multicloud Environment

Multicloud is defined as using cloud computing services from at least two different providers. Instead of a single-cloud stack, the user will plan out a combination of services. They can choose the features that suit their needs from a wide range of service providers. Many businesses use multi-cloud environments. A company can reduce expenses by using several cloud service providers and mixing their offerings. This approach helps them make the most of their resources and gain flexibility.

New Feature: Custom Kubernetes Annotations

Kubernetes annotations are key-value pairs attached to Kubernetes objects, providing a flexible way to extend the functionality of your Kubernetes resources without altering their internal specifications. These annotations serve as a tool to store additional metadata to tailor behavior, orchestrate tools, and interact seamlessly with third-party utilities that complement your Kubernetes environment.
